The leading Chinese AI start-up has confidentially filed for a Hong Kong listing and aims to go public early next year, sources say
Chinese artificial intelligence start-up Moonshot AI – developer of the leading Kimi K3 model – has confidentially filed for an initial public offering in Hong Kong, according to two people with knowledge of the matter, as the firm seeks to tap public markets to fund its rapid expansion.

The Beijing-based company was targeting a Hong Kong listing as early as the first quarter of 2027, the sources told the South China Morning Post, asking not to be identified as the information was private.

The timeline remained subject to regulatory approvals and market conditions, they added.

Moonshot said it “doesn’t comment on market rumours or speculation” in a response to a query sent by the SCMP on Thursday.

Moonshot made headlines in July with the release of its Kimi K3 model: the world’s largest open-weight AI model with more than 2.8 trillion parameters, which refers to the sophistication of AI systems with larger sizes usually indicating stronger capabilities.
